在保留数据的同时更新实时数据库的最佳方法?(Best way to update a live database while persisting data?)
简而言之; 我为朋友创建了一个小型WinForms应用程序。
当我的朋友使用该应用程序时,我决定对应用程序进行更改。 这样做我在数据库中的表中添加了几列。
我现在想要实现这些更改,在保持数据完好的同时,使用所有新列更新数据库的最佳方法是什么?
提前致谢!
In short; I have created a small WinForms application for a friend.
Whilst my friend was using the application I decided to make changes to the application. In doing so I added a few columns to tables within the database.
I now want to implement that changes, what is the best way to get his database up to date with all the new columns whilst keeping his data intact?
Thanks in advance!
原文:https://stackoverflow.com/questions/19290544
最满意答案
我们必须使用jQuery来获取选择,querySelector是不够的。
We have to use jQuery to get the selection, querySelector is not enough.
相关问答
更多-
问题是..我忘了提供一个container 。 这是一个工作的例子: $carouselScroller .velocity('scroll', { container: $carousel, offset: slide * screen.width, duration: 200, axis: 'x', easing: 'linear', c ...
-
你为什么不使用 $("#menuContainer").velocity({width: '-=260px'}, 500); 对于50%的宽度,您可以使用: var menu=$("#menuContainer"); menu.velocity({width:menu.width()/2}, 500); Why don't you use $("#menuContainer").velocity({width: '-=260px'}, 500); For 50% width, yo ...
-
我们必须使用jQuery来获取选择,querySelector是不够的。 We have to use jQuery to get the selection, querySelector is not enough.
-
你在寻找从jdk 8u上运行的jdk9 openjdk源生成的nashorn二进制文件吗? 不,那是不可能的。 源代码甚至不会用jdk8u编译。 Are you looking for nashorn binary generated from jdk9 openjdk source that is runnable on jdk 8u? No, that is not possible. The source won't even compile with jdk8u.
-
我不得不添加一个例外,即所有版本的ie忽略我的速度模糊实例。 之后,代码忽略了模糊并完美运行。 I had to add an exception that all versions of ie ignore my instances of velocity blur. After that the code ignored the blur and ran perfectly.
-
铯的ES6风格进口(ES6 style import for cesium)[2023-11-17]
Cesium是一个node.js模块,这意味着它使用module.exports的node.js模块语法,而不是export default { }的ES6模块规范。 为了在前端使用Cesium和ES6,你需要像Browserify或Webpack这样的东西,它允许你使用import Cesium from 'cesium' Cesium 。 Cesium is a node.js module, which means it uses the node.js module syntax of module ... -
根据Daniel Rosenwasser,在tsconfig.json "compilerOptions"部分设置"allowJs": true就可以了。 我根本不必使用.d.ts文件。 Per Daniel Rosenwasser, setting "allowJs": true in the tsconfig.json "compilerOptions" section did the trick. I didn't have to use a .d.ts file at all.
-
只需确保包含velocity-ui.js ,并以与以前相同的方式使用它们 - Velocity(document.getElementById("dummy"), "slideDown", { duration: 1000 }); jQuery帮助器函数简单地从第一个参数中提取元素列表 - 不要忘记你可以将任何元素查找方法的结果传递给第一个参数,包括document.querySelectorAll (甚至jQuery,如果你想)。 Just make sure you include velocity- ...
-
确保你在 VelocityJS 之前加载jQuery - 如果它以错误的顺序完成,那么Velocity将不知道jQuery存在并且将绑定为window.Velocity()而不是 - 这需要以稍微不同的方式调用。 编辑:为了将来的参考,jQuery和VelocityJS顺序是正确的,但是用户函数正在两者之间加载而不是等待document.ready - 因此令人困惑的调试。 Make sure you load jQuery before VelocityJS - if it's done in the w ...
-
ES6多重继承?(ES6 multiple inheritance?)[2023-03-31]
这只是逗号运算符的一个令人困惑的情况。 (1, 2) // 2 (1, 2, 3) // 3 (first, second) // second 它不会抛出错误,因为它是有效的语法,但是它在您期望的任何意义上都不起作用 。 third只会继承second 。 我们可以通过编译ES5语法来验证是否是这种情况,以检查它是否影响类定义。 var third = (function (_ref) { _inherits(third, _ref); function third() { _clas ...